Abstract

A module comprising: a first transmit filter that passes a transmission signal of a first band; a first receive filter that passes a reception signal of the first band; a second transmit filter that passes a transmission signal of a second band; a second receive filter that passes a reception signal of the second band; a third transmit filter that passes a transmission signal of a third band; and a third receive filter that passes a reception signal of the third band, wherein a transmit band of the first band overlaps with at least a part of a receive band of the second band, a receive band of the third band does not overlap with the transmit band of the first band or a transmit band of the second band, and the third receive filter is located between the first receive filter and the second receive filter.
